Parallel Slopes
When two lines have parallel Slopes they have the same slope but different y-intercepts
Examples
y = 2x +5
y =2x +3

Multiple Choice
You are running the concession stand at a basketball game. You sell hot dogs for $2 and sodas for $0.75. To cover overhead expenses, you need to make more than $180. Write an inequality to find how many hot dogs and sodas you need to sell. Let x equal the number of hot dogs and y equal the number of sodas.
y > x + 180
x + y > 180
0.75x + 2y > 180
2x + 0.75y > 180
62
Multiple Choice
Your school is hosting a spaghetti dinner as a fundraiser. You estimate 200 adults and 250 children will attend. Let x be the cost of adult tickets and y the cost of a child ticket. Write an inequality to represent what ticket prices to set to raise at least $3200.
x + y ≥ 3200
250x + 200y ≥ 3200
200x + 250y ≤ 3200
200x + 250y ≥ 3200
63
Multiple Choice
Allen enjoys gardening. Every sunflower plant he waters requires 0.7 liters of water, and every rose bush he waters requires 0.5 liters of water. Allen has a total 11 liters of water for these plants. Write an inequality to represent the situation.
0.7s - 0.5r ≥ 11
0.7s + 0.5r ≥ 11
0.7s + 0.5r ≤ 11
0.7r + 0.5s ≤ 11
